class abstractclassmethod(classmethod):
"""A decorator indicating abstract classmethods.
Similar to abstractmethod.
Usage:
class C(metaclass=ABCMeta):
@abstractclassmethod
def my_abstract_classmethod(cls, ...):
...
"""
__isabstractmethod__ = True
def __init__(self, callable):
callable.__isabstractmethod__ = True
super(abstractclassmethod, self).__init__(callable)

class jobQueue:
"""Wrapper around queue.Queue to be able to shutdown. This will be supported in python 3.13 but for now
this will be enough.
"""
def __init__(self, qs):
"""Constructor
:param qs: max queue size
"""
self._queue = Queue(qs)
self._shutdown = False
self._condition = Condition()
[docs]
def put(self, item):
"""Puts an item into the queue without blocking.
If queue is shutdown, the item will not be added to the queue and this will be done silently
:param item: the item to add to the queue
"""
with self._condition:
try:
if not self._shutdown:
self._queue.put(item, block=False)
finally:
self._condition.notify_all()
[docs]
def get(self, waittime=10):
"""Returns an item from the queue. The wait time is the time in seconds the
thread should wait in the condition until checking for any new item in the queue.
This condition will be notified whenever put or shutdown is called.
:param waittime: The time to wait in seconds inside the condition
:return: Will always return an item
:throws: pubQueueShutdown
"""
with self._condition:
while not self._shutdown:
try:
return self._queue.get_nowait()
except:
if not self._shutdown:
self._condition.wait(waittime)
raise jobQueueShutdown()
[docs]
def task_done(self):
"""Call this when task grabbed from queue is finished
"""
self._queue.task_done()
[docs]
def shutdown(self):
"""Shuts down the queue.
"""
with self._condition:
self._shutdown = True
self._condition.notify_all()
